How to Use Pcs Emoji
On Mobile
Access your emoji keyboard and find the pcs emoji, or simply copy it from this page and paste it into your message.
On Desktop
Copy the emoji from this page and paste it into your text. On Windows, you can also use Win + . (period) to open the emoji picker.
